Who we are
The Chartered Physiotherapists in Scoliosis Management Niche Group (CPSMNG) is a professional subgroup of the Irish Society of Chartered Physiotherapists (ISCP). We are ISCP members and CORU-registered chartered physiotherapists with a specific interest and expertise in the assessment and management of scoliosis.
The aim of the CPSMNG is to advance high‑quality physiotherapy assessment and management of scoliosis by supporting physiotherapists to deliver evidence‑based, standardised care through education, collaboration, and advocacy.
What we do
- Facilitate a professional network to support communication and collaboration among physiotherapists involved in scoliosis management.
- Promote the standardisation of best practice in scoliosis assessment and management.
- Support and deliver education and CPD activities.
- Provide clinical and professional advice to the ISCP on matters relating to scoliosis.
- Highlight and support physiotherapy involvement in conservative, pre‑operative and post‑operative scoliosis care.
- Advocate for the role of physiotherapy in the management of all types of scoliosis.
- Liaise with multidisciplinary healthcare professionals and consultants involved in the care of people with scoliosis.
